StarGirl

I used to dream I would be abducted by this beautiful space princess
The girl from space who would come down to earth just for me,
and steal me away to another place.
We lived there alone, on our own special world, in our own special house.
We ran around holding hands, looking at strange and wonderful things together
We couldn’t talk the same language, but it didn’t matter to us,
we knew what each other was thinking by looking in each others eyes,
I could tell she loved me because she had special eyes,
Special eyes with stars in the middle.

Stargirl.
